There are strategies to assert yourself and gain recognition for your contributions if you understand a few things carefully:
Complaining that your hard work is going unnoticed is acting like a victim; if you want to be seen as a leader, take ownership and responsibility. Blaming others for your lack of recognition or opportunities is counterproductive. It’s all about taking the reins of your own destiny. Waiting around for someone else to notice your hard work? That’s like watching paint dry – painfully slow and not very rewarding. If you’re eyeing a promotion or aiming for some well-deserved recognition, you’ve got to be proactive. Take the initiative to make yourself known, if there are things you do that are making your organization better then put it in writing strategically and add all important people in cc to make your work known, don’t keep things verbal.
Don’t be afraid to advocate for yourself and your contributions. Volunteer for additional responsibilities, and high-impact projects, propose innovative ideas, and speak up in meetings to share your expertise and insights. Ensure consistent proactive reporting where you discuss and present your tasks and initiatives without being asked for. Asserting yourself in a professional manner can help you gain recognition for your talents and contributions.
Dealing with favoritism and lack of support can be disheartening, but it’s essential to remain resilient. Focus on your goals, continue to invest in your professional development, and don’t let setbacks deter you from pursuing opportunities for growth and advancement.
Instead of doing repeat tasks, sit and identify 10 -30 areas where your organization struggles; then think which of these areas can be made better just by paying attention and creating templates, systems, using AI, pick up an area, make a difference in this area, test your system well then share it with your seniors not to seek recognition but offer to share the same knowledge with other departments to make their day to day functioning easier and plugging a loophole. Every organization yearns for leaders who are proactive, If you prove to be a leader you will become indispensable for your organization. This is what would not just get you noticed but admired and promotion-ready.
